Palladium is seeking a Master Trainer Consultant to train primary health care facility staff on the components of VRBFP service provision; and support the development of facility action plans. Based in Kaduna, Nigeria, the Master Trainer will receive four days of intensive training on the VRBFP approach, how to facilitate health facility-level trainings, and how to support the development of action plans. The Consultant will then travel to up to four health facilities across the state to conduct the trainings and action planning, under the direct supervision of the project’s Training Officer and Program Manager.This is a part-time position with an expected start duartion of April 2016 – August 2016, up to 40 days LOE.To view the complete Scope of Work please click HERE


Job Title:   Master Trainer Consultant

Minimum Education and Experience Required

  • Minimum of a Bachelor’s degree in Public Health or other related discipline from a recognized institution. Educational background in nursing, midwifery and family planning preferred
  • At least 5 years of professional experience, with emphasis on training/building capacity
  • Fluency in Hausa and English


Primary Responsibilities 

  • Develop skills and expertise on the VRBFP approach as well as how to facilitate training events for health personnel using a VRBFP curriculum, through a four-day Palladium-hosted training event
  • Build relationships with community/religious leaders, sharing the VRBFP approach and generating buy-in for health facility personnel training events
  • Execute two-day training events on the VRBFP approach—using a Palladium-designed curriculum—in up to four primary health facilities across the state, for various cadre of health personnel. Day one of the training will build skills on the VRBFP approach, and day two will focus on action planning
  • Conduct post-training follow-up activities in-person, to including filling capacity building gaps through coaching and mentorship on the VRBFP approach
  • Develop (in coordination with the Training Officer and Project Manager) and disseminate materials to support the implementation of facility action plans. Materials can include posters, pamphlets, job aids, and other products
  • Hold regular debrief sessions with the VRBFP Project Team (Training Officer and Project Manager)
  • Performs other related duties and responsibilities as assigned


Key Competencies

  • Experience with FP service delivery preferred
  • Knowledge of rights-based family planning principles a plus
  • Experience managing effective relationships with community and religious leaders.
  • Willing and able to travel throughout Kaduna state regularly to support project activities
